After playing hard today, all of a sudden the drive stopped. Engine fine, but transmission feels broken. Will not shift into gear. Feels like its in neutral. I have TowBoats US, thank God.

Boat is 1988 Wellcraft Aruba with 350 stern drive and Alpha 1.

You need to find out what is wrong first, a 350 and Alpha 1 are fine, the Alpha will handle 300 HP with no problem. You need to do some diagnostics, get the engine cover off, move the shift lever, does the cable to the drive move, is it broken, stretched, drain the oil, is there metal in it. Did the engine get warm after it broke? If it didnt I would think that power was being transferred to the water pump. That indicate a bad cable or a problem in the lower gears by the prop shaft/clutch dog. If it got warm I would suspect the ujoints or the upper gears.
